Requirements
~2 min read1. Expected work day: Eight (8) hours.
2. Regular and punctual attendance required.
3. Provide clerical support for supervisors assigned.
4. Monitor visitors for security purposes.
5. Type from straight copy/rough draft.
6. Use copy machines and other business machines.
7. Compile and type statistical and written reports.
8. File-alphabetic, subject, numeric, and geographic.
9. Answer telephone calls and route incoming, outgoing, and interoffice calls as required.
10. Meet and assist visitors in a helpful, courteous and professional manner.
11. Assist parents and others in acquiring information and making contact with the appropriate Central Office Personnel.
12. Compose and type letters of transmittal and routine letters of inquiry, requests, and information.
13. Open and sort mail, collect and distribute parcels, transmit and deliver facsimiles, update calendars, prepare travel vouchers, and perform basic bookkeeping as assigned.
14. Assist with work permits and required reports to the State as assigned.
15. Substitute for employees in other Central Office departments as assigned.
16. Maintain the confidentiality of any school system related information.
17. Maintain proper and professional relationships.
18. Perform duties in a manner that promotes good public relations.
19. Follow Board policies and procedures.
20. Possess visual acuity.
21. Possess physical ability to carry items under 25 pounds.
22. Possess physical and emotional ability and dexterity as needed to perform assigned tasks in a fast-paced, high intensive work environment.
23. Perform other reasonable job-related duties as might be assigned by supervisors.
TERMS OF EMPLOYMENT: Twelve Month contract. NON-EXEMPT EMPLOYEE.
EVALUATION: Performance will be evaluated in accordance with Support personnel evaluation system and Board policy.
SALARY: Appropriate placement on current salary schedule.
